Anubias barteri 'Broad Leaf' is a robust, attractive plant with large, round green leaves that make it a great addition to any freshwater aquarium. This variety of Anubias is known for its easy care and ability to thrive in a range of water conditions, making it an excellent choice for both new aquarists and seasoned professionals. Its broad leaves add a lush, natural appearance to your aquascape, providing visual appeal and a natural habitat for aquarium fish and invertebrates.
Anubias 'Broad Leaf' is propagated through rhizome division. To propagate, simply cut a section of the rhizome (the main stem) that has a few healthy leaves and attach it to your desired surface. It's important to keep the rhizome above the substrate to prevent it from rotting. You can secure it to rocks, driftwood, or other decorations using aquarium-safe thread or glue.
